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54 33 300 0519526469 78981520
6602635908 946545
6602635908 946545
2358140066 76 8697636 156
All about undefined
Interested in learning more?
6602635908 946545
2358140066 76 8697636 156
See more
205 5167 42563377094
1602382364 22230 89429
See more
825084 75
59 616 461977573
See more